Barn drainage installation services involve setting up systems designed to effectively direct excess water away from a property’s foundation, landscape, or structures. This process typically includes the placement of underground pipes, drainage tiles, or other components that help manage water flow during heavy rains or flooding events. The goal is to prevent water accumulation in unwanted areas, reducing the risk of water damage, soil erosion, and foundation issues. Proper installation ensures that water is channeled efficiently to designated drainage points, helping maintain the integrity of the property’s landscape and structures.

These services are essential for addressing common drainage problems such as standing water, soggy lawns, or basement flooding. When excess water is not properly diverted, it can lead to persistent moisture issues, mold growth, and structural deterioration over time. Barn drainage installation helps resolve these concerns by creating a controlled pathway for water to exit the property safely. This can be particularly beneficial in areas with poor natural drainage, heavy rainfall, or uneven terrain that causes water to collect in specific zones.

Labor Costs - The labor for barn drainage installation typically ranges from $500 to $2,500, depending on the barn size and complexity of the drainage system. Larger or more complex setups may incur higher labor charges. Contact local service providers for precise estimates based on specific project needs.

Material Expenses - Materials such as drainage pipes, gravel, and fabric can cost between $300 and $1,200. Prices vary based on the quality and quantity of materials required for the installation. Local pros can provide detailed material cost estimates tailored to the project.

Permitting and Inspection - Permitting fees and inspection costs generally range from $100 to $500, depending on local regulations. These costs are separate from installation expenses and vary by location. Consult with local contractors for specific permit requirements and fees.

Total Project Cost - Overall costs for barn drainage installation typically fall between $1,000 and $5,000. Factors influencing the total include barn size, drainage system complexity, and regional pricing differences. Contact local specialists for accurate project cost estimates.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is barn drainage installation? Barn drainage installation involves setting up systems to effectively direct excess water away from barn foundations and surrounding areas to prevent flooding and water damage.

Why is proper drainage important for barns? Proper drainage helps protect the structural integrity of the barn, reduces the risk of water-related issues, and maintains a safe environment for livestock and equipment.

What types of drainage systems are commonly installed? Common systems include French drains, surface drains, and sump pumps, tailored to address specific drainage needs around a barn.

How do local contractors determine the best drainage solution? Contractors assess the property's topography, soil type, and water flow patterns to recommend the most effective drainage methods.
